How do I find marriage records in Nevada?

To obtain a marriage or a divorce record, write to the recorder of the county where the event took place. Nevada marriage records are open to the public. When consulting the originals one may find licenses in one county office and the certificate series in another location.

How long does it take to get marriage license in Vegas?

How long does it take to get a marriage license in Las Vegas? The process itself does not take long. Once you are with the clerk it only takes about 15 minutes. However, we cannot guarantee how many other couples will show up at the same time to get their marriage license.

What paperwork is needed to get married in Vegas?

Proof of name and age will be required, so don’t forget to bring your valid driver’s license, passport, military ID card or other government-issued ID card. Other combinations of ID that contain your photograph along with an original/certified birth certificate or social security card are cool too.

Do you need witnesses to get married in Nevada?

Couples have one year from the date of receiving the marriage license to get married in Las Vegas. The couple must bring their marriage license and IDs to the officiant. Note that the couple will need one (1) witness to the wedding ceremony (most wedding chapels can supply one). The couple may recite their own vows.

How much does a marriage license cost in Nevada?

To be legally married in the State of Nevada, you must purchase a marriage license and have a marriage ceremony performed. The fee for the license is $85.00 (Cash, Credit Card, Money Order, Cashier’s Check, or Traveler’s Check). The marriage license may be obtained up to one year prior to the ceremony.

Can you get a marriage license the same day in Las Vegas?

Yes, you can receive your marriage license and get married the same day in Las Vegas. Click here to see the requirements for obtaining a marriage license. Nevada has no blood test or waiting period. The Marriage License Bureau is open from 8 a.m. to midnight, 365 days per year and does not take appointments.

Are marriage records public in California?

Are California marriage records public? California is unique in that it offers both confidential and public marriage licenses. Roughly one in five marriages in the state was confidential in 2012 and in 1982 it was one in three. The state has offered confidential marriages since 1878.

How do I find out when my parents got married?

Go to the county records office.

  1. You need to go with as much information as you have about the marriage in question.
  2. This should include at least the names of the couple and the place of the marriage.
  3. If you know approximately when they were married, this could help narrow the search.
